Modern electric door handles on EVs can complicate passenger evacuation during an accident.
KatadataOTO – Some time ago, an accident occurred involving a Tesla Cybertruck electric car in the United States, which was carrying four teenage passengers.
However, only one person managed to survive. This accident has drawn attention because it could have been anticipated.
The Tesla Cybertruck reportedly hit a tree, and a fire was seen emerging from the car, suspected to be from the battery. The four teenagers in the cabin were still in good condition.
Unfortunately, as the fire grew, all passengers in the cabin could not get out because the door handles stopped working due to the impact of the crash.
Since the door handles operate electrically, the component could not be used when the electrical current was cut off. The doors also could not be opened from outside the vehicle.
There is one cable that serves as an alternative to open the rear doors in an emergency, but its location is quite hidden.
In Indonesia, a number of the latest Electric Vehicles (EVs) have started using flush-style electric door handles.
Although they enhance the car's appearance, hidden door handles can potentially complicate the evacuation process from outside the vehicle during an accident.
A representative from the vehicle safety testing agency ASEAN NCAP has also spoken out in response to this issue.
“This could potentially serve as a reference for future research to be developed into a testing protocol,” said Adrianto Sugiarto Wiyono, Technical Committee of ASEAN NCAP, to KatadataOTO on Wednesday (21/01).
He revealed that the ASEAN NCAP testing standards do not yet include an assessment of ease of access in the event of an accident.
Moreover, cases where drivers and passengers are trapped in a vehicle after an accident are not numerous.
As long as the car windows can be opened or broken, the evacuation process can still be facilitated.
In the future, manufacturers need to consider these factors when designing vehicles. The hope is that accidents similar to the Tesla Cybertruck incident in the US can be anticipated.
“This also requires further study. The vehicle's safety will be measured during the crash or post-crash,” he asserted.
Manufacturers, especially electric car manufacturers, can make design adjustments by paying attention to the safety of passengers in the cabin.
Especially for electric car producers. Because the risk of fire from the battery in an EV is quite high, and the fire is difficult to extinguish.
